Team Falcons remain undefeated at DreamLeague Season 27
Team Falcons successfully defended their Club Championship title at the 2025 Esports World Cup. Team Falcons knocked OG from the unbeatens to stand alone in first place on Sunday at DreamLeague Season 27.
OG now share a 4-1 record with Team Spirit and Virtus.pro.
The $1 million Dota 2 event features 24 teams starting in a Swiss System group stage. All matches are best-of-three, with the top eight teams advancing to the double-elimination playoffs, which run from Dec. 17-21.
Playoff matches will all be best-of-three ahead of the best-of-five grand final.
The championship team will receive $200,000 in prize money and a $30,000 club reward. The runner-up side will get $125,000 and a $25,000 club reward.
Team Falcons beat OG in 29 minutes and 56 minutes on red. Stanislave "Malr1ne" Potorak of Russia recorded a 26-8-38 total kills-deaths-assists ratio for Team Falcons. Teammate Andreas "Cr1t" Nielsen of Denmark posted a 17-11-34 K-D-A ratio.
